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Saliva tests
  • Blood tests
  • Urine tests
  • Hair analysis
  • Sweat patches

Breathalyzer - Efficient for roadside DUI law enforcement.

Saliva tests - Quick screening tool for recent use.

Blood tests - Accurate measurements for medical and legal analysis.

Urine tests - Detects less recent alcohol consumption.

Hair analysis - Long-term consumption patterns detection.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ing provides a forensic measure of substance use by analyzing samples from both fingernails and toenails. This non-invasive test offers insight into long-term drug exposure, as nails capture metabolites over a significant time.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Can reveal drug exposure for up to 6 months
  • Toenails: Often used for a longer detection period of up to 12 months

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Assesses if an employee is fit for specific job tasks.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ures protective equipment efficacy.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Measures lung function for at-risk workers.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screens for infectious diseases.
  • Vision: Monitors eye health and readiness for visual tasks.
  • Audiometric: Tests hearing to prevent occupational hearing loss.

If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
